Unleash Creativity: Tips for Successful Thinking Outside the Box

Creativity is essential to the success of any business. Tapping into the innovative minds of employees can provide new perspectives and push industries forward. Here are ten tips on how to unlock creativity and unleash it for the benefit of the company.

Tip 1: Believe in Yourself

The first step in unleashing creativity is having the confidence to believe in yourself. Self-doubt can be the biggest barrier to thinking creatively. Acknowledge that you are capable of thinking outside the box and push yourself to take risks and try new things.

Tip 2: Embrace Diversity

To encourage out-of-the-box thinking, organizations must embrace diversity. This not only includes diversity of culture and experiences but diversity of thought as well. A team that includes individuals with varied backgrounds and experiences can help an entity gain a competitive edge.

Tip 3: Break the Monotony

Breaking the monotony of routine can spark creative thinking. A change of environment, routine, or even just a break from working on the same task can help the mind relax and bring about new ideas. Be proactive in creating opportunities to break the monotony of work.

Tip 4: Encourage Brainstorming Sessions

Brainstorming sessions provide a platform for unfiltered ideas to flow without fear of criticism. Encouraging team members to brainstorm together can unlock creative solutions and often bring about innovations that may not have been considered before. It fosters a culture of collaboration and helps individuals refine each other’s ideas.

Tip 5: Foster a Learning Environment

Curiosity fuels creativity, making it necessary to foster a learning environment within the team. Encouraging continuous learning through provided training sessions or access to books, podcasts, and other resources can help motivate individuals to seek knowledge, gain new perspectives, and bring innovative ideas to the table.

Tip 6: Challenge Assumptions

Assumptions can trap organizations in habitual behaviors that create limitations, making it hard to think outside the box. Challenging norms is healthy for innovation. Helping team members to question assumptions and think beyond limits can lead to the creation of better solutions.

Tip 7: Look at the Big Picture

Thinking outside the box requires the ability to see beyond one’s immediate needs and look at the big picture. By developing a clear understanding of the industry and the market, including consumer needs, individuals and teams can take lessons learned from other markets, apply them to their own, and find new solutions to old problems. It’s essential to keep an eye on emerging trends and changes in the market.

Tip 8: Keeping Things Simple

Sometimes thinking outside the box means simplifying processes. Overcomplicating things can often provide opportunities to be creative, but simplicity is one of the most valued concepts in business. The simpler a solution, the easier it is to maintain, scale, and make accessible to consumers.

Tip 9: Emphasize on Fun

Injecting fun in the work environment can help loosen up colleagues and encourage more creative thinking. Providing moments of lightheartedness can reduce stress levels within teams and create moments of joy, ultimately leading to new concepts and ideas.

Tip 10: Take Time to Meditate

Taking time to meditate can help boost creative thinking by calming the mind and increasing focus. Meditation helps eliminate external distractions and reduces stress levels. Encourage your team to take a few moments to meditate during work, or provide opportunities to do so outside of work.
